Transaction 83b8520e7b4d6f3ace585f277a35a4e69038bc6a8102cd175c53be9f4bac61d8

block
81053ac6418c9a7bcaa3c6c8d476d716915afabf911cc27615bb22cd5fd289e0

1 Input

23 Outputs